This is sort of an embarrasing question to ask. Did anyone's TOM last longer than usual after starting this diet? Mine is usually on 3-4 days - but has been on and off for over a week (not a chance that I have a bun in the oven) didn't know if anyone had the same issue - also, would this cause me to not be dropping the weight off?

Today i feel so bloated and fat - I have been drinking plenty of water????

I used to work in a women's clinic with OB/GYN's and I know that any radical changes to a woman's body can affect her menstrual cycle so don't be surprised. It may take a couple months to adjust to all the changes then go back to normal. I wouldn't panic too much about it.

RMT, it's always a good idea to get these kind of things checked out, just to be sure. But Lucy Lover is right, it's not worth panicking...it's very common for changes in diet to affect TOM, especially when you lose weight...estrogen and fat have a very co-dependent relationship and when you lose fat, it affects estrogen and thus affects your TOM. Check with your doc to make sure, but don't stress about it. :
